Win a copy of The Little Book of Impediments (e-book only) this week in the Agile and Other Processes for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

CMP remote component interface business methods

 
Ramakrishnan Ponmudi
Ranch Hand
Posts: 72
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
i have 2 question regd CMP
i)In CMP's component interface, is it legal to have setPrimaryKeyField(String key)?
i get remote exceptions when calling this method.
ii)is it possible to change more than one field for a entity in the database using a business method.
 
Greg Charles
Sheriff
Posts: 3002
12
Firefox Browser IntelliJ IDE Java Mac Ruby
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
i) No, it is illegal to expose setters for the primary key fields to the client.

ii) Yes, of course your business methods can do whatever they want (except change the primary key!) In the implementation of these methods you would call several of the abstract setters that are implemented by the container.
 
Ramakrishnan Ponmudi
Ranch Hand
Posts: 72
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i Greg Charles, thanks for your answer.
is it mentioned in spec.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ic